Exemplo n.º 1
0
        private void btnAgregarTitulo_Click(object sender, EventArgs e)
        {
            // CREA LOS OBJETOS
            clsTitulos      objTitulo = new clsTitulos();
            clsDatosTitulos objDatos  = new clsDatosTitulos();


            // LEE LOS DATOS DE LAS CAJAS Y LOS GUARDA EN EL OBJETO
            objTitulo.TituloId  = Convert.ToInt32(txtIdTitulo.Text);
            objTitulo.Nombre    = txtNombreTitulo.Text;
            objTitulo.Precio    = Convert.ToDecimal(txtPrecioTitulo.Text);
            objTitulo.Genero    = txtGeneroTitulo.Text;
            objTitulo.Fecha     = (txtAnio.Text + Convert.ToString(cbMes.Text) + Convert.ToString(cbDia.Text));
            objTitulo.Notas     = txtNotas.Text;
            objTitulo.Reagalias = txtRegalias.Text;



            // INSERTA AL PRODUCTO MEDIANTE EL MÉTODO
            objDatos.AgregarTitulo(objTitulo);
            // MUESTRA MENSAJE DE CONFIRMACION
            MessageBox.Show("Producto registrado", "Insertar", MessageBoxButtons.OK, MessageBoxIcon.Information);
            frmTitulos Titulos = new frmTitulos();

            this.Hide();
            Titulos.Show();
        }
Exemplo n.º 2
0
        private void btnActualizarTitulo_Click(object sender, EventArgs e)
        {
            // CREA LOS OBJETOS
            clsTitulos      objTitulo = new clsTitulos();
            clsDatosTitulos objDatos  = new clsDatosTitulos();

            //Productos obj = new Productos();


            // LEE LOS DATOS DE LAS CAJAS Y LOS GUARDA EN EL OBJETO
            objTitulo.TituloId  = Convert.ToInt32(txtId.Text);
            objTitulo.Nombre    = txtNombre.Text;
            objTitulo.Genero    = txtGenero.Text;
            objTitulo.Cantidad  = Convert.ToInt32(txtCantidad.Text);
            objTitulo.Notas     = txtNotas.Text;
            objTitulo.Precio    = Convert.ToDecimal(txtPrecio.Text);
            objTitulo.Reagalias = txtRegalias.Text;
            // INSERTA AL PRODUCTO MEDIANTE EL MÉTODO
            objDatos.ModificarTitulo(objTitulo);
            // MUESTRA MENSAJE DE CONFIRMACION
            MessageBox.Show("Empleado Modificado", "Insertar", MessageBoxButtons.OK, MessageBoxIcon.Information);
            frmTitulos Titulos = new frmTitulos();

            this.Hide();
            Titulos.Show();
        }
Exemplo n.º 3
0
        private void txtCantidad_KeyPress(object sender, KeyPressEventArgs e)
        {
            if ((int)e.KeyChar == (int)Keys.Enter)
            {
                agregarVenta();

                // CREA LOS OBJETOS
                clsTitulos      objTitulo = new clsTitulos();
                clsDatosTitulos objDatos  = new clsDatosTitulos();

                // LEE LOS DATOS DE LAS CAJAS Y LOS GUARDA EN EL OBJETO
                objTitulo.TituloId = Convert.ToInt32(txtID.Text);
                objTitulo.Cantidad = Convert.ToInt32(txtCantidad.Text);
                // INSERTA AL titulo MEDIANTE EL MÉTODO
                objDatos.RestarInventario(objTitulo);
                btnVender.Visible = true;

                /*txtID.Text = "";
                 * txtProducto.Text = "";
                 * txtPrecio.Text = "";
                 * txtCantidad.Text = "";*/
            }
        }
Exemplo n.º 4
0
        private void button4_Click(object sender, EventArgs e)
        {
            // CREA LOS OBJETOS
            clsDatosTitulos datos  = new clsDatosTitulos();
            clsTitulos      titulo = new clsTitulos();


            titulo.TituloId = Convert.ToInt32(dgvTitulos.Rows[dgvTitulos.SelectedRows[0].Index].Cells[0].Value.ToString());



            DialogResult result = MessageBox.Show("Seguro que deseas eliminar?", "", MessageBoxButtons.YesNoCancel);

            // REFRESCA LOS DATOS Y MUESTRA EL MENSAJE "ELIMINADO"
            if (result == DialogResult.Yes)
            {
                titulo.TituloId = Convert.ToInt32(dgvTitulos.Rows[dgvTitulos.SelectedRows[0].Index].Cells[0].Value.ToString());
                datos.EliminarTitulo(titulo);

                mostrarTitulos();
                MessageBox.Show("Producto eliminado");
            }
        }
Exemplo n.º 5
0
        private void button3_Click(object sender, EventArgs e)
        {
            clsTitulos      objTitulo = new clsTitulos();
            clsDatosTitulos objdatos  = new clsDatosTitulos();

            objTitulo.TituloId = Convert.ToInt32(this.dgvTitulos.CurrentRow.Cells[0].Value.ToString());
            objdatos.buscarTitulo(ref objTitulo);

            frmEditarTitulos x = new frmEditarTitulos();

            x.label1.Visible = false;
            x.label2.Visible = true;

            x.txtId.Text       = Convert.ToString(objTitulo.TituloId);
            x.txtNombre.Text   = objTitulo.Nombre;
            x.txtGenero.Text   = objTitulo.Genero;
            x.txtAnio.Text     = objTitulo.Fecha;
            x.txtCantidad.Text = Convert.ToString(objTitulo.Cantidad);
            x.txtNotas.Text    = objTitulo.Notas;
            x.txtPrecio.Text   = Convert.ToString(objTitulo.Precio);
            x.txtRegalias.Text = objTitulo.Reagalias;

            x.txtId.Enabled       = false;
            x.txtNombre.Enabled   = true;
            x.txtGenero.Enabled   = true;
            x.txtAnio.Enabled     = false;
            x.txtCantidad.Enabled = true;
            x.txtNotas.Enabled    = true;
            x.txtPrecio.Enabled   = true;
            x.txtRegalias.Enabled = true;


            x.Show();

            this.Close();
        }
Exemplo n.º 6
0
        private void mostrarTitulos()
        {
            clsDatosTitulos objTitulo = new clsDatosTitulos();

            dgvTitulos.DataSource = objTitulo.getTitulos();
        }